A Very Joe Bob Christmas Plot

Forget Rudolph, Santa and Frosty! This year, spend the holidays at the Drive-In with Joe Bob Briggs.

The Last Drive-in: Just Joe Bob A Very Joe Bob Christmas aired on December 21st, 2018.

A Very Joe Bob Christmas Episodes

1. Phantasm

December 21st, 201843 min

Joe Bob gives viewers intoxication instructions and begins to divulge the history of the Don Coscarelli franchise Phantasm (1979).

2. Phantasm III

December 21st, 201851 min

After ranting about the unthinkable destruction of a 1971 Plymouth Hemi 'Cuda in "Phantasm II," Joe Bob skips ahead to the third movie and then chats with star Reggie Bannister.

3. Phantasm IV

December 21st, 201838 min

Joe Bob tells a Christmas story about his mentally-challenged nephew, and then he grows so increasingly befuddled by Phantasm IV: Oblivion (1998) that he ties Reggie Bannister to a chair and forces him to answer questions about the film.

4. Phantasm Ravager

December 21st, 201839 min

Joe Bob discusses Linus's speech from A Charlie Brown Christmas (1965), then "Phantasm" FX lady Gigi Bannister stops by for a chat and finally, Joe Bob leads a Christmas sing-along.
